我有一个自定义库包含在Qt中。目前,通过在.pro文件中添加以下内容来包含它。
INCLUDEPATH += ...
DEPENDPATH += ...
LIB += ...
由于我的大多数项目都使用了该库。我想知道如果有一些方法可以使我的自定义库与QtSDK集成?也许它可以像内置组件
这样的语法包含在内QT += my_custom_library
并且所有内容(头文件包括路径,lib文件包括等等)都将完成。
整合是否可行?
答案 0 :(得分:4)
您可能正在寻找创建一个mkspec文件,然后将其与CONFIG选项一起使用。因此,创建一个包含指令的$ QT_HOME / mkspec / features / mycoollib.prf文件。该目录中应该有很多示例。该文件的名称声明了它的用法,因此文件mycoollib.prf将被用作:
CONFIG += mycoollib